ControlDesigner.Invalidate Methode
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Erklärt das auf der Entwurfsoberfläche angezeigte Steuerelement für ungültig und bewirkt, dass der Entwurfshost die OnPaint(PaintEventArgs)-Methode aufruft.
Überlädt
Invalidate(Rectangle) |
Macht den angegebenen Bereich des auf der Entwurfsoberfläche angezeigten Steuerelements ungültig und weist den visuellen Designer an, das Steuerelement neu zu zeichnen. |
Invalidate() |
Macht den gesamten Bereich des auf der Entwurfsoberfläche angezeigten Steuerelements ungültig und weist den visuellen Designer an, das Steuerelement neu zu zeichnen. |
Hinweise
Aufrufen UpdateDesignTimeHtml der Methode wird auch aufgerufen Invalidate .
Invalidate(Rectangle)
Macht den angegebenen Bereich des auf der Entwurfsoberfläche angezeigten Steuerelements ungültig und weist den visuellen Designer an, das Steuerelement neu zu zeichnen.
public:
void Invalidate(System::Drawing::Rectangle rectangle);
public void Invalidate (System.Drawing.Rectangle rectangle);
member this.Invalidate : System.Drawing.Rectangle -> unit
Public Sub Invalidate (rectangle As Rectangle)
Parameter
- rectangle
- Rectangle
Ein Rectangle-Objekt, das den ungültig zu machenden Bereich darstellt, relativ zur linken oberen Ecke des Steuerelements.
Hinweise
Verwenden Sie die SetViewFlags Methode in der Initialize Methode, um den Steuerelement-Designer zum Behandeln von Farbereignissen zu aktivieren.
Die Invalidate Methode stellt den Entwurfshost mit einer Möglichkeit bereit, den Steuerelement-Designer anzuweisen, einen bestimmten Teil des Steuerelements neu zu zeichnen.
Siehe auch
Gilt für
Invalidate()
Macht den gesamten Bereich des auf der Entwurfsoberfläche angezeigten Steuerelements ungültig und weist den visuellen Designer an, das Steuerelement neu zu zeichnen.
public:
void Invalidate();
public void Invalidate ();
member this.Invalidate : unit -> unit
Public Sub Invalidate ()
Hinweise
Verwenden Sie die SetViewFlags Methode in der Initialize Methode, um den Steuerelement-Designer zum Behandeln von Farbereignissen zu aktivieren.
Die Invalidate Methode stellt den Entwurfshost mit einer Möglichkeit bereit, den Steuerelement-Designer anzuweisen, das Steuerelement neu zu zeichnen. Im Wesentlichen ist dies die gleiche wie die Aufrufmethode UpdateDesignTimeHtml , da das gesamte Steuerelement neu gezeichnet werden kann.